Friday afternoon, Samsung posted a picture on its Instagram site that shows what most likely is the Samsung Galaxy S6. The phone is shown in profile, revealing a thin design. The image is similar to a video teaser that we told you about this morning. And in the background we see some sort of metal. This confirms that Samsung has finally decided to listen to the multitude of customers who were getting tired with the plastic build employed for Samsung's most recent flagship models.
